| Functional Description ? help Back to Top | ||||||
|---|---|---|---|---|---|---|
| Source | Description | |||||
| UniProt | Mediates E2-dependent ubiquitination (By similarity). Confers resistance to osmotic stress such as high salinity. Promotes H(2)O(2) production. Negative regulator of some defense-related genes via an salicylic acid (SA)-dependent signaling pathway. Confers susceptibility to the compatible phytopathogen Pseudomonas syringae pv. tomato strain DC3000 (Pst DC3000). Mediates resistance to type A trichothecenes (phytotoxins produced by phytopathogenic fungi). {ECO:0000250, ECO:0000269|PubMed:16905136, ECO:0000269|PubMed:18069941, ECO:0000269|PubMed:19704430}. | |||||

| Regulation -- Description ? help Back to Top | ||||||
|---|---|---|---|---|---|---|
| Source | Description | |||||
| UniProt | INDUCTION: By brassinosteroids, osmotic stress and high salinity. Accumulates in response to SA, ethylene, methyl jasmonate (MeJA), flagellin (e.g. flg22), and type A trichothecenes such as T-2 toxin and diacetoxyscirpenol (DAS), but not in response to type B trichothecenes such as deoxynivalenol (DON). {ECO:0000269|PubMed:16905136, ECO:0000269|PubMed:18069941, ECO:0000269|PubMed:19704430}. | |||||
